Established in 2009, Blue Line Sterilization Services has been driven to reducing the time to market for innovators designing new medical devices. The company differentiates itself by maintaining a bank of 8 cubic foot ethylene oxide (EO) sterilizers, providing FDA and EU compliant sterilization with turnaround times of approximately 1 to 3 days—an achievement not achievable with larger EO sterilization services.
Co-founders Brant and Jane Gard noticed the critical need for accelerated sterilization options, particularly for fast-paced development programs innovating innovative medical devices. The ability to swiftly navigate through device iterations is paramount in reducing the need for additional funding, preserving the value of investors' equity, and expediting time to market. Faster service and reduced time to market hold valuable value for employees, investors, and the patients benefiting from improved medical care.
Besides routine sterilization, Blue Line offers rapid turnkey validations and small batch releases that support clinical trials and FDA/CE submissions. Collaborating with Blue Line enables developers of new medical devices to markedly shorten their schedules, promptly assess new design iterations, and expedite product launches.

Critical Role of Medical Device Sterilization
Controlling infections remains a core component of modern medicine.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) estimate that around 1 in 31 hospital patients experiences at least one healthcare-associated infection (HAI). Thorough sterilization of medical devices significantly reduces the risk of these infections, safeguarding patients and healthcare providers as well. Improper sterilization can bring about outbreaks of major diseases like hepatitis, HIV, and antibiotic-resistant bacterial infections.
Medical Device Sterilization Methods
The science behind sterilization has developed extensively over the last century, using a variety of methods suited to various types of devices and materials. Some of the most commonly employed techniques include:
Sterilization by Autoclaving
Autoclaving remains the most frequent and trusted method of sterilization, particularly suitable for surgical instruments and reusable metal devices. Using high-pressure saturated steam at temperatures around 121–134°C, autoclaving effectively kills bacteria, viruses, fungi, and spores. This method is fast, cost-efficient, and environmentally safe, although not suitable for heat-sensitive materials.
Innovative Innovations in Medical Instrument Sterilization
As the field grows, several key trends are impacting sterilization processes:
Sustainable Sterilization Practices
As environmental regulations increase, companies are steadily developing green sterilization options. Strategies include curtailing reliance on dangerous chemicals like ethylene oxide, exploring reusable packaging strategies, and optimizing electricity use in sterilization practices.
Advanced Materials and Device Complexity
The emergence of intricate medical devices—such as robotic surgery instruments and intricate diagnostic equipment—demands sterilization systems capable of handling detailed materials. Innovations in sterilization include methods especially low-temperature plasma sterilization and hydrogen peroxide vapor, which can sterilize without damaging fine components.
Digital Documentation and Compliance
With advances in digital technology, monitoring of sterilization procedures is now more precise than ever. Digital traceability systems offer in-depth documentation, automated compliance checks, and real-time notifications, significantly minimizing human error and boosting patient safety.
